Transaction 5122673aa51569d2a5dfc40005b27ee55032133c83f61dd7b675f2b49246889a
1 Input
1 Output
-
5122673aa51569d2a5dfc40005b27ee55032133c83f61dd7b675f2b49246889a:0
- value
- 61023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b2cfc917f9bb277f842a3cb5cf47ca532ae149f OP_EQUAL
- address
- 3ENujvzBqKLez3qZZMDaHYLK5bBtDexdMi